About the position

An Assistant Community Manager is a challenging position that uses sales, customer service, and exceptional management skills to handle the day-to-day operations of an apartment community and its staff. There are three core categories of responsibilities: Management, Leasing, and Customer Service.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ain the physical and fiscal assets of the community
  • Complete all resident move-ins, move-outs, transfers and renewals
  • Inspect vacant apartments to ensure rental readiness and perform move-out inspections
  • Supervise and motivate onsite personnel to achieve the operational goals of the property
  • Liaise and collaborate with regional and senior management
  • Ability to professionally resolve resident and employee issues
  • Attend court, as necessary
  • Uphold and enforce all company policies, processes, and procedures
  • Work in collaboration with leasing consultants and regional marketing team to develop and implement appropriate marketing strategies
  • Conduct tours of the grounds of the community and show apartments to prospective residents
  • Sell the community over the phone/internet to convert leads to on-site tours
  • Greet all individuals that enter the leasing office in a friendly and professional manner
  • Maintain thorough product knowledge of the property (floor plans, amenities, etc.) and the local community
  • Apply product knowledge to prospective residents’ needs by effectively communicating features and benefits
  • Develop and maintain professional relationships with prospective and current residents
  • Accept maintenance requests, submit maintenance tickets, and complete follow-up to ensure satisfaction
  • Handle resident calls and in-person concerns
  • Respect boundaries of tenant confidentiality, ensure safety and uphold both local and Federal Fair Housing Laws
  • Accurately prepare and be thoroughly knowledgeable with all applications, lease documents, and related paperwork
  • Collect and process rental payments
  • Facilitate the move-in and move-out process
  • Maintain property records
  • Assist with payroll
